Help for rough sleepers in Guildford

Guildford has many services to help rough sleepers. These include:

  • homelessness outreach and support service
  • day service
  • night shelter
  • hostels and supported housing projects
  • a range of services providing specialist support  
  • agencies providing general and specialist advice including money and debt advice
  • support with voluntary work and access education, training and employment opportunities
  • services to improve health and wellbeing

What we do

We commission the Homeless Outreach and Support Team (HOST) to provide support to:

  • rough sleepers
  • people at risk of rough sleeping

HOST is a point of contact to report potential rough sleepers. They respond to reports by finding the rough sleeper and offering help.
